⦿ Key Developments
- Gold lost its 50-DMA in March and has been unable to reclaim it during rebounds, indicating downward momentum.
- Analysts highlight the confluence of the 200-DMA and a multi-year trend line near $4,350 as critical support for gold prices.
- If gold fails to hold this support level, it could decline towards $4,100, with recent highs acting as resistance levels.
- The key $4,500/oz level has been erased, emphasizing the importance of holding the 200-DMA at $4,353/oz to prevent a deeper correction.
- A short-term rebound could face resistance at the recent pivot high around $4,685 / $4,775.
